Even since the field of AI began in the 1950s, people have insisted it will never be creative. For decades, this view was easy to accept.But today it sounds far less convincing. We are surrounded by AIs that write compelling text, compose music, create images, and produce video—tasks once thought to require human creativity alone. In the 20th century, new ideas came from human minds; in the 21st, they may increasingly come from AI systems.
